2014 BWP to BIF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2014

During 2014, the BWP to BIF ex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on May 14, valuing the pair at 178.8856.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on December 27, dropping to 162.8299.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 16.0558 BIF.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 173.4862 to the December average rate of 165.5166, the exchange rate registered a net change of -4.59% (reflecting a weakening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2014 high of 178.8856 was down 9.54% compared to the 2013 peak of 197.7472,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

BWP to BIF Seasonal Trends & Volatility Analysis

A structured review of seasonal halves, trading extremes, consecutive streaks, and historical baselines.

Seasonal Halves (H1 vs H2)

Seasonal

The average exchange rate in the first half of the year (H1: Jan–Jun) was 175.1885, compared to 170.8338 in the second half (H2: Jul–Dec). This shows that the rate was stronger in the first half (Jan–Jun) by a margin of 4.3547 points.

Volatility Range Comparison

Volatility

The most volatile month in 2014 was January, with a trading range of 7.9540 BIF (High: 177.4641 / Low: 169.5101). On the other end, May was the most stable month, with a tight range of 2.3244 BIF (High: 178.8856 / Low: 176.5612).

Growth Streaks & Declines

Trends

Between February and May, the exchange rate recorded its longest consecutive growth streak of the year, climbing for 3 straight months. Conversely, the sharpest month-over-month decline occurred between August and September, when the average rate fell by 4.2269 points.

Same-Month Historical Baseline

YoY Baseline

Comparing the current year's strongest month average (May 2014: 177.7679) against the same month in 2013 (average: 189.4368), the exchange rate shifted by -11.6689 (-6.16%).
